wanted: regex or code to find valide def statements in a line
#1
in a text file may be lines that look like valid python def statements. there may be various other things like "def" appearing in a different context. i would like to find some code or a regex that can determine if the entire line is a valid def statement or not. if valid it must return the function name. if not valid it must return something that test false in an if statement. this is just one line being tested. the body of the function may not even be present. but the entire line must be a complete and valid def statement.
